Riding your bicycle has more benefit than you think

Transport sustainability

We know it is fun to ride a bike and we see families enjoying a pleasurable ride along the linear park at weekends. There is more benefit: For each 100 kilometres a commuter cyclist rides, the community benefits by more than $70 in avoided congestion and other road costs, as well as health improvements. Have a look at www.cyclingpromotion.com.au and you will see how cycling saves money, improves air quality, reduces noise, improves health and reduces health costs. An overall benefit to our quality of life and that of our neighbourhood.
